30 ASTDeclList, ///< Parse ASTs and list Decl nodes.
31 ASTDump, ///< Parse ASTs and dump them.
32 ASTPrint, ///< Parse ASTs and print them.
33 ASTView, ///< Parse ASTs and view them in Graphviz.
34 DumpRawTokens, ///< Dump out raw tokens.
35 DumpTokens, ///< Dump out preprocessed tokens.
36 EmitAssembly, ///< Emit a .s file.
37 EmitBC, ///< Emit a .bc file.
38 EmitHTML, ///< Translate input source into HTML.
39 EmitLLVM, ///< Emit a .ll file.
40 EmitLLVMOnly, ///< Generate LLVM IR, but do not emit anything.
41 EmitCodeGenOnly, ///< Generate machine code, but don't emit anything.
42 EmitObj, ///< Emit a .o file.
43 FixIt, ///< Parse and apply any fixits to the source.
44 GenerateModule, ///< Generate pre-compiled module from a module map.
45 GenerateModuleInterface,///< Generate pre-compiled module from a C++ module
47 GeneratePCH, ///< Generate pre-compiled header.
48 GeneratePTH, ///< Generate pre-tokenized header.
49 InitOnly, ///< Only execute frontend initialization.
50 ModuleFileInfo, ///< Dump information about a module file.
51 VerifyPCH, ///< Load and verify that a PCH file is usable.
52 ParseSyntaxOnly, ///< Parse and perform semantic analysis.
53 PluginAction, ///< Run a plugin action, \see ActionName.
54 PrintDeclContext, ///< Print DeclContext and their Decls.
55 PrintPreamble, ///< Print the "preamble" of the input file
56 PrintPreprocessedInput, ///< -E mode.
57 RewriteMacros, ///< Expand macros but not \#includes.
58 RewriteObjC, ///< ObjC->C Rewriter.
59 RewriteTest, ///< Rewriter playground
60 RunAnalysis, ///< Run one or more source code analyses.
61 MigrateSource, ///< Run migrator.
62 RunPreprocessorOnly ///< Just lex, no output.

217 /// \brief Enable migration to modern ObjC literals.
218 ObjCMT_Literals = 0x1,
219 /// \brief Enable migration to modern ObjC subscripting.
220 ObjCMT_Subscripting = 0x2,
221 /// \brief Enable migration to modern ObjC readonly property.
222 ObjCMT_ReadonlyProperty = 0x4,
223 /// \brief Enable migration to modern ObjC readwrite property.
224 ObjCMT_ReadwriteProperty = 0x8,
225 /// \brief Enable migration to modern ObjC property.
226 ObjCMT_Property = (ObjCMT_ReadonlyProperty | ObjCMT_ReadwriteProperty),
227 /// \brief Enable annotation of ObjCMethods of all kinds.
228 ObjCMT_Annotation = 0x10,
229 /// \brief Enable migration of ObjC methods to 'instancetype'.
230 ObjCMT_Instancetype = 0x20,
231 /// \brief Enable migration to NS_ENUM/NS_OPTIONS macros.
232 ObjCMT_NsMacros = 0x40,
233 /// \brief Enable migration to add conforming protocols.
234 ObjCMT_ProtocolConformance = 0x80,
235 /// \brief prefer 'atomic' property over 'nonatomic'.
236 ObjCMT_AtomicProperty = 0x100,
237 /// \brief annotate property with NS_RETURNS_INNER_POINTER
238 ObjCMT_ReturnsInnerPointerProperty = 0x200,
239 /// \brief use NS_NONATOMIC_IOSONLY for property 'atomic' attribute
240 ObjCMT_NsAtomicIOSOnlyProperty = 0x400,
241 /// \brief Enable inferring NS_DESIGNATED_INITIALIZER for ObjC methods.
242 ObjCMT_DesignatedInitializer = 0x800,
243 /// \brief Enable converting setter/getter expressions to property-dot syntx.
244 ObjCMT_PropertyDotSyntax = 0x1000,
245 ObjCMT_MigrateDecls = (ObjCMT_ReadonlyProperty | ObjCMT_ReadwriteProperty |
246 ObjCMT_Annotation | ObjCMT_Instancetype |
247 ObjCMT_NsMacros | ObjCMT_ProtocolConformance |
248 ObjCMT_NsAtomicIOSOnlyProperty |
249 ObjCMT_DesignatedInitializer),
250 ObjCMT_MigrateAll = (ObjCMT_Literals | ObjCMT_Subscripting |
251 ObjCMT_MigrateDecls | ObjCMT_PropertyDotSyntax)
